📝 Description

Authored by Laura Hillenbrand, 'Unbroken' tells the incredible true story of Louis Zamperini, an Olympic runner whose B-24 bomber crashed in the Pacific during World War II. He survived 47 days adrift at sea, only to be captured by the Japanese Navy and endure years of brutal torture as a prisoner of war. The book is a testament to human endurance and the power of the human spirit.
